One Pot Turkey Chili

This one pot turkey chili gives a healthy dinner spin to a classic comfort food. With a few simple steps, you'll have it ready in no time!

– 1 tablespoon avocado oil – 1 yellow onion 1 cup – 1 bell pepper 1 cup – 1 lb ground turkey – 3 tablespoon chili powder – 2 tablespoon cumin – 2 tablespoon honey – 2 tablespoon tomato paste – 1 tablespoon garlic powder – 1 and ½ teaspoon salt – ½ teaspoon black pepper – 1 and ½ cups water – 1 14 oz can crushed tomatoes – 1 can red kidney beans – 1 7 oz can tomato sauce

1.

Cook the avocado oil and the chopped peppers and onions about 5-8 minutes until softened.

2.

Add the ground turkey. Use a wooden spoon to break the meat into small pieces until cooked through.

3.

Stir in the seasonings, tomato paste and honey. Cook for 1-2 minutes until fragrant.

4.

Stir in the water, crushed tomatoes, beans and tomato sauce and cook for 30 minutes, stirring occasionally.

Try including: – Sweet Potatoes – Cauliflower – Zucchini – Butternut Squash – Carrots – Broccoli – Spinach (Stir it in to wilt in the last 5 minutes) – Mushrooms
